AMN Healthcare has successfully placed 17 Travel Physical Therapist Assistant professionals in high-demand positions across Wisconsin, offering competitive pay and career-enhancing experiences. These previously filled jobs had weekly pay ranging from $1,138 to $1,666, with an average of $1,500, reflecting the strong earning potential for Outpatient Physical Therapy Assistant and Skilled Physical Therapy Assistant professionals.

Most travel Physical Therapist Assistant positions in Wisconsin require prior clinical experience in a variety of settings, particularly in outpatient care or rehabilitation facilities. Additionally, candidates often need to demonstrate proficiency in patient treatment techniques and effective communication skills to collaborate with healthcare teams.
In Wisconsin, travel positions for Physical Therapist Assistants are typically found in hospitals, rehabilitation centers, and long-term care facilities. These healthcare settings often seek temporary staff to fill gaps in care or respond to patient demand.
Common specialties for a Physical Therapist Assistant working a travel job in Wisconsin include orthopedics, geriatrics, and sports rehabilitation. Many facilities also seek professionals who can assist in neurological rehabilitation and pediatrics due to the diverse patient populations in the state. Travel assignments often require adaptability to different clinical environments and treatment approaches. Consequently, Physical Therapist Assistants may gain experience across a broad range of settings and specialties during their travels.

In Pewaukee, Physical Therapist Assistants can earn between $1,502 and $1,666 per week, making it an attractive option for those looking to maximize their earning potential. Known for its stunning lake views and a welcoming community atmosphere, Pewaukee also boasts a cost of living that is relatively modest compared to larger metropolitan areas. Sturgeon Bay presents a slightly lower pay range for Physical Therapist Assistants, from $1,371 to $1,580 per week, but offers a lifestyle rich in culture and community engagement. Situated on the Door Peninsula, this city features a cost of living that is very reasonable, making it accessible for professionals from various backgrounds. Fennimore rounds out our list of cities with an enticing pay range for Physical Therapist Assistants, between $1,284 and $1,480 per week. This quaint city offers a cost of living that’s appealingly lower than national averages, making it a perfect fit for individuals looking to balance affordable living with a fulfilling career.
